摘要:阿里开发规范文档致力于构建高效、统一的编程标准,为开发者提供清晰的指导和建议,以确保代码质量、可读性和可维护性。该文档涵盖了前端开发、后端开发、测试等多个方面,旨在提高开发效率,减少错误和重复工作,促进团队协作和代码共享。遵循这些规范,开发人员可以更加便捷地编写出高质量、符合阿里标准的代码。
本文目录导读:
随着阿里巴巴业务的快速发展,为了保障软件开发的规范化、提高代码质量、降低维护成本,阿里开发规范文档的制定和实施显得尤为重要,本文旨在介绍阿里开发规范文档的相关内容,帮助开发者遵循统一的编程标准,提升团队协作效率。
阿里开发规范文档概述
阿里开发规范文档是一套针对阿里巴巴内部开发的规范和准则,涵盖了编程风格、命名规则、代码结构、异常处理、日志管理、测试要求等方面,这些规范旨在提高代码的可读性、可维护性,降低开发成本,保证软件质量。
1、编程风格规范:规定代码缩进、空格、注释等基本格式要求,确保代码风格统一,提高代码可读性。
2、命名规范:对变量、函数、类、模块等命名进行规定,要求命名简洁、明确,表达意图清晰。
3、代码结构规范:规定代码的组织结构,包括模块划分、函数职责划分等,确保代码结构清晰,便于维护和扩展。
4、异常处理规范:对程序中的异常处理进行规定,包括错误码定义、错误日志记录等,确保程序在遇到异常时能够妥善处理。
5、日志管理规范:规定日志的书写、分类、级别等要求,方便问题排查和性能分析。
6、测试要求规范:强调单元测试和集成测试的重要性,规定测试方法、测试覆盖率等要求,确保软件质量。
实施与遵守
为了落实阿里开发规范文档,阿里巴巴采取了一系列措施:
1、培训与宣传:通过内部培训、文档宣传等方式,让开发者了解并熟悉规范文档的内容和要求。
2、编码审查:实施严格的代码审查制度,确保代码符合规范文档的要求。
3、工具支持:研发相关工具,对代码进行自动检查,提示不符合规范的地方。
4、考核与激励:将规范遵守情况纳入开发者绩效考核,激励开发者遵循规范。
阿里开发规范文档的优势
1、提高代码质量:通过遵循统一的规范,提高代码的可读性、可维护性,降低代码出错率。
2、提升团队协作效率:遵循相同的编程规范,减少团队成员之间的沟通成本,提高协作效率。
3、降低维护成本:清晰的代码结构、规范的命名和注释,使得代码维护更加便捷,降低维护成本。
4、保障软件质量:通过严格的测试要求,确保软件质量,提高用户满意度。
阿里开发规范文档是阿里巴巴在软件开发过程中的重要成果,为提高代码质量、提升团队协作效率、降低维护成本提供了有力保障,作为开发者,我们应该积极学习和遵守规范文档,不断提高自己的编程技能,为阿里巴巴的发展做出贡献,我们也应该认识到,规范的制定和实施是一个持续的过程,需要不断地完善和优化,以适应业务的发展和技术的进步。
未来展望
随着技术的不断发展,阿里巴巴的业务也在不断扩展,这对我们的开发规范提出了更高的要求,我们将继续完善阿里开发规范文档,探索更加适应业务发展和技术进步的规范体系,我们也将加强规范的宣传和培训,提高开发者的规范意识,为阿里巴巴的持续发展提供有力保障。